Description
Topics in current social, political, and cultural issues in Latin America and Spain, including advanced skills in Spanish reading, listening, speaking, and writing.
- Prerequisites: HISP 219, HISP 220 or equivalent
- Taught in Spanish. Native and heritage speakers welcome.
